是否有 C/C++ IDE 在编译前不会提示保存?

Is there a C/C++ IDE that wouldn't prompt to save before compiling?

本文关键字:提示 保存 编译 C++ IDE 是否      更新时间:2023-10-16

对我来说是一个常见的情况:我脑子里有一个代码的想法(在这个例子中,它是在Python中(,所以我打开PyScripter,编写代码,然后简单地运行它。PyScripter 不会要求我事先保存代码,几秒钟后我就会高兴地看一眼算法的结果。

现在我明白 C 是一种编译语言,代码必须事先保存,等等,但我想知道是否有这样的 IDE,让你简单地享受你的代码,而没有很多保存的文件或文件夹名为 "test1.*""test2.*" 等......

我想可以做到这一点的一种方法是,IDE 将管理临时文件夹中的所有项目文件,直到(如果有的话......(用户单击"保存/另存为";然后它实际上会将文件保存在所需的位置。因此,在大多数情况下,如果用户只想编写代码并查看其输出,IDE 不会用保存提示打扰用户。

如果

有人可以向我推荐这样的IDE(如果它们存在的话(,我会很高兴。提前非常感谢=]


编辑:@Michael伯尔 是的,一开始的目的确实不是想出文件名。

你可以试试 ideone.com。我觉得很方便:-(

它是在线的,因此不需要实际安装,并且它支持许多已知的编程语言。

对于C++,你可以在Visual Studio中执行此操作。下次修改文件时,只需按F5(运行(,当出现提示时(询问您是否要在编译前保存文件(,只需选中显示Don't ask again的框。

对于Java,Eclipse(也许是其他的(提供了自动编译,但你仍然需要保存文件。您只需要检查Build Automatically.

CodePad似乎就是出于这个原因而创建的。编写代码,点击按钮,看着它运行。没有大惊小怪,也没有保存数百个文件。

http://codepad.org/

如果你使用 emacs:

   (defun my-emacs-command-save-compile ()
    "save and compile."
    (interactive)
    (save-buffer)
    (recompile))